THE THERMAL SOLAR COLLECTOR
It represents the most common application in order to produce sanitary warm water and/or to heat the buildings. A square meter of solar collector can heat up to 60-70 °C between the 70 and 300 liters of water in a day in function of the efficiency, than varied with the latitude, the climatic conditions and the types of collector.
The heart of a solar collector is the absorber, which is usually composed of several narrow metal strips. The carrier fluid for heat transfer flows through a heat-carrying pipe, which is connected to the absorber strip. In plate-type absorbers, two sheets are sandwiched together allowing the medium to flow between the two sheets. Absorbers are typically made of copper or aluminum.

Solar thermal systems also differ by the type of collector used to gather and store the sun's energy.

The Solar Collectors are connected in series or in parallel. They constitute a reliable and competitive technology on the market and come widely uses you for the following scopes:
- heating of the sanitary water to domestic, hotel use and hospital worker;
- heating of the water of the showers (bathing establishments, you camp, etc.);
- heating of atmospheres (optimal is the coupling of a thermal solar system with a system of heating to pavement);
- heating of the water for processes to low temperature;
- drying of agricultural and food- products;
